2-2. Charging
Plug-in hybrid system
■ Charging ends earlier than time set in “Departure” or “Departure
time”
■ Charging is not complete, even though it is time set in “Departure”
or “Departure time”
“Battery Heater” (P.128) operated
When the charging mode is set to
“Departure” or “Departure time”, “Battery
Heater” may operate before charging
starts. Check the status of the charging
indicator of the charging port. (P.107)
Outside temperature is low and hybrid
battery (traction battery) warming control
(P.128) operated (Greenland only)
When hybrid battery (traction battery)
warming control operates, the charging
schedules are ignored and charging
starts. In order to protect the hybrid bat-
tery (traction battery), allow charging to
continue.

“Climate Prep” or “Climate preparation” is
set to on
When “Climate Prep” or “Climate prepa-
ration” is set to on, the air conditioning
operates until the set departure time.
Therefore, charging may not complete by
the set time due to charging conditions.
To have the hybrid battery (traction bat-
tery) fully charged, allow charging to con-
tinue.
Charging end time does not match esti-
mated end time due to condition of power
source or outside temperature
If sudden changes in temperature or
changes in the condition of the power
source occur while charging, charging
may not end exactly at the time esti-
mated by the system.
